Cleveland Heights leads in median household income ($69,155 vs $45,018). Cleveland Heights leads in walk score (53 vs 37). Euclid leads in crime level (6.0 vs 6.9).

Metric-by-Metric Breakdown

Metric Cleveland Heights, OH Euclid, OH
WhereAtHome Score 82.2 (#30) 79.1 (#141)
Population 43,908 48,212
Typical Home Value (ZHVI) $211,115 $150,362
Median Household Income $69,155 $45,018
Average Commute 22.4 min 25 min
Walk Score 53 37
Crime Level 6.9 6.0
School Rating N/A N/A
Cost of Living Index 92 85
Political lean County 2024 presidential margin — context only, not scored D+31.5 D+31.5
